Understanding the Basics of UPS
A UPS provides emergency power by storing energy in batteries and delivering it when the main power fails. It protects your devices from power surges and outages, ensuring continuous operation of critical electronics such as routers, modems, or medical devices.
Key Factors to Consider When Choosing a UPS Under $100
- Power Capacity (VA and Wattage): Ensure the UPS can handle the total power draw of your devices.
- Battery Runtime: Check how long the UPS can power your essential devices during an outage.
- Number of Outlets: Make sure there are enough outlets for your devices, including surge protection.
- Form Factor: Consider whether a compact or tower design suits your space.
- Additional Features: Look for features like USB charging ports, LCD displays, and automatic voltage regulation.

Tips for Maintaining Your UPS
To ensure your UPS remains effective, follow these maintenance tips:
- Regular Testing: Periodically disconnect the load to test battery runtime.
- Keep Batteries Charged: Avoid long periods of disuse to prevent battery deterioration.
- Keep It Clean: Dust and debris can affect cooling and operation.
- Replace Batteries When Needed: Follow manufacturer recommendations for battery replacement.
